Field Description
Cluster Name Enter a unique name for the cluster.
Make your cluster names logically consistent with their
purpose. For example,
Sales Web, Customer Support Web,
and so on.
License Key Enter GoColdFusion. This field is case-sensitive, so be sure
to enter the key exactly as shown.
Web Server Name Enter the fully qualified host name (for example,
doc.allaire.com) for the first server you want to be a
member of this cluster.
You cannot create an empty cluster; you must specify a Web
server that will be part of the cluster. If this is the first server
that you have added to the cluster, it is known as the Admin
Manager. The remaining steps guide you in configuring the
Admin Manager.
Bring Up in Passive
Mode
Select this checkbox to bring the Admin Manager up in
Passive mode. If you do not select this checkbox, the server
will be brought up in Active mode.
For more information on passive/active modes, refer to
Changing Active/Passive Settings on page 309.
ClusterCATS
Maintenance
Support
Select the ClusterCATS Maintenance Support check box to
enable support for offline maintenance.. The Admin Manager
must be configured with a maintenance IP address.
Using maintenance support requires that your cluster
support ClusterCATS dynamic IP addressing. For more
information, refer to ClusterCATS Dynamic IP Addressing
(Windows only) on page 334.
Offline maintenance support is only available on Windows
NT server clusters. You can only set the maintenance
support option when creating a cluster or adding a cluster
member to a cluster. You cannot configure or modify this
option after you have created and added the cluster member
to the cluster.
Maintenance
Address
Enter the fully qualified host name of the maintenance
address (for example,
serv1.yourcompany.com). This field
is only accessible if you selected ClusterCATS Maintenance
Support.
